You may be wondering why I refer to the McKinsey 7S model here.  The answer is simply that this is one very useful tool among the many that I have in my toolbox when embarking on an organisation change project.  


In large organisations particularly, I have found the McKinsey 7S model useful in identifying all the connections between hard and soft elements that need to be taken into account.  


For example, top management may not see themselves as ​necessarily being directly involved in changes to processes involving one or more departments.  They may not realise the impact their management style has on the way people work.

​The 7S model helps them to understand the essential interconnections and how weaknesses in one particular element (in this case a soft element) can affect the performance of the organisation as a whole.  It identifies appropriate actions necessary to align all soft and hard elements with the strategic objectives of the organisation.


Depending upon the project scope, size of organisation and other factors, the 7S model may or may not be a tool selected for the job. Others, such as BPR, TQM, Force Field Analysis or simply mapping the processes in a particular department may be appropriate.  Often, a combination is required in much the same way as a worker may use a hammer for one task and a screwdriver for another.

How people are managed at work needs to change! Whatever the mix of home and office working, management needs to care more for their employees.  


Research by the CIPD shows high incidences of stress and anxiety resulting in absenteeism; a third of people say their mental health has become worse during the pandemic (Mind).  Managers must get to know their employees better, learn to identify potential areas of concern at the individual level and how to respond appropriately; a vital step for achieving strategic objectives.
